ABA Ethics Committee Issues Guidance on Terminating Client Representations

The ABA’s ethics committee weighed in on Model Rule 1.16’s requirements for withdrawing from representation, cautioning attorneys to avoid breaking the “hot potato” rule.

Two Labor, Employment Bills to Watch This Session

One bill would add three professions to the “highly compensated workers” exemption for the state’s new noncompete law and the other restricts “surveillance pricing” for wages and consumer prices alike.
